51單片機(jī)的編程實(shí)例 51單片機(jī)循環(huán)語句有幾種?
51單片機(jī)循環(huán)語句有幾種?在51單片機(jī)程序中,循環(huán)語句一般由for、while和do來實(shí)現(xiàn)...而。在循環(huán)中可以使用Countun開發(fā)51單片機(jī)用什么軟件編程?51單片機(jī)使用keil C51編寫程序。
51單片機(jī)循環(huán)語句有幾種?
在51單片機(jī)程序中,循環(huán)語句一般由for、while和do來實(shí)現(xiàn)...而。
在循環(huán)中可以使用Countun
開發(fā)51單片機(jī)用什么軟件編程?
51單片機(jī)使用keil C51編寫程序。
單片機(jī)80c51如何讓兩段keil c程序?qū)懺谝黄?,成一個(gè)keill c程序?
將其中一個(gè)程序另存為***。件,放在程序運(yùn)行的文件夾下,在另一個(gè)程序的開頭加上#includ
51單片機(jī)要控制多個(gè)汽缸實(shí)現(xiàn)如下定時(shí)?怎么寫匯編程序?
這很簡單。設(shè)置定時(shí)器工作,開始時(shí)啟動(dòng)定時(shí)器,設(shè)置第二個(gè)變量sec,if(sec1),1缸啟動(dòng)if(sec 4){ 1缸停止,2/3缸啟動(dòng)} if(sec6){氣功1啟動(dòng),3缸停止,4缸啟動(dòng)}
51單片機(jī)的匯編語言怎么燒錄?
不管是匯編語言程序還是C語言程序,51單片機(jī)的燒錄過程都是一樣的。首先將程序編譯成一個(gè)十六進(jìn)制文件,然后利用專門的下載工具軟件,通過串口1將該十六進(jìn)制文件燒錄到單片機(jī)的程序存儲器中。
匯編語言編程和C語言編程的主要區(qū)別只是編譯過程,不影響怎么燒。
51單片機(jī)如何延遲到250納秒?
對于那些老型號的51單片機(jī)來說,沒有辦法獲得250nS的程序延遲,因?yàn)樗鼈冏羁斓闹噶钜惨?微秒。
目前主流的51單片機(jī)提高了主頻,采用了流水線結(jié)構(gòu),所以指令執(zhí)行時(shí)間縮短到了幾百皮秒,做250納秒的延遲不成問題。
新51單片機(jī)的指令周期大多是一個(gè)時(shí)鐘。你可以根據(jù)單片機(jī)當(dāng)前的主頻計(jì)算出它的時(shí)鐘周期,然后計(jì)算出延時(shí)子程序中安排了多少條空閑操作指令,這樣就可以完成250納秒的延時(shí)。
51單片機(jī)編程程序怎么編?
51單片機(jī)如何編程?
?這種技術(shù)問題在今天 的頭條,幾乎沒有專家給你答案。因?yàn)閷W(xué)習(xí)51單片機(jī)編程程序需要長篇大論,并用電腦操作截圖來說明每一步。付出不等于收入,沒有人會做不好的生意。
?我是今日推薦的問答 今天早上的頭條新聞。本著負(fù)責(zé)任的態(tài)度,真誠的告訴頭條上有需要的讀者,最好花幾十塊錢在網(wǎng)上買一本51單片機(jī)C語言課程的書,在家慢慢讀。俗話說:交錢學(xué)藝術(shù),學(xué)藝術(shù)賺錢。
如果要我回答51單片機(jī)編程程序的步驟,只有幾個(gè)大步驟:
①雙擊啟動(dòng)Keil軟件;
(2)啟動(dòng)新項(xiàng)目;
(3)命名并保存新項(xiàng)目;④選擇單片機(jī)的型號;
⑤在新項(xiàng)目中加入C語言;
⑥為最終的十六進(jìn)制文件設(shè)置相關(guān)選項(xiàng);
⑦開始編譯并生成所需的十六進(jìn)制文件。
這些步驟連我都覺得很無力,何況是新手?,F(xiàn)在網(wǎng)絡(luò)發(fā)達(dá),不像我們這個(gè)時(shí)代,所有的知識都是從書本上獲取,老師不厭其煩的講解。網(wǎng)上有很多關(guān)于單片機(jī)編程程序的視頻,何必上今日頭條呢?
?物聯(lián)網(wǎng)時(shí)代單片機(jī)技術(shù)和應(yīng)用得到了前所未有的發(fā)展,對單片機(jī)開發(fā)和應(yīng)用人才的數(shù)量和要求也越來越高。有人認(rèn)為單片機(jī)技術(shù)內(nèi)部結(jié)構(gòu)復(fù)雜,編程語言抽象,學(xué)習(xí)難度大,在實(shí)際應(yīng)用中與其他元器件知識和電子通信技術(shù)相互關(guān)聯(lián)。但是,一個(gè)設(shè)計(jì)通常需要結(jié)合很多軟硬件技術(shù),往往一開始就很難入手。如何循序漸進(jìn)的學(xué)習(xí)單片機(jī),從新手到專家?
事實(shí)上, "新概念51單片機(jī)C語言教程郭天祥編輯的非常適合初學(xué)者。他的書 "總攻之路(第二版)的引進(jìn)、改進(jìn)、發(fā)展與拓展 "為高級學(xué)習(xí)提供了一個(gè)很好的途徑。
單片微型計(jì)算機(jī)一臺工作的計(jì)算機(jī)必須有: CPU(用于操作和控制)、RAM(用于數(shù)據(jù)存儲)、ROM(用于程序存儲)和輸入輸出設(shè)備(如:串行端口和并行輸出端口)等部件。在個(gè)人電腦上,這些部件被分成幾個(gè)芯片,安裝在一個(gè)叫做主板的印刷電路板上。在單片機(jī)中,所有這些部件都集成在一個(gè)集成電路芯片上,所以稱為單片機(jī)(單片)機(jī),有些單片機(jī)除了上述部件外,還集成了AD AD、d a等其他部件。一臺個(gè)人電腦中的中央處理器將賣幾千美元,所以許多事情是一起做的,你可以 不買天價(jià)!另外,這個(gè)芯片必須非常大。
祝提問者早日學(xué)會51單片機(jī)編程程序,成為服務(wù)社會經(jīng)濟(jì)發(fā)展的高手,賺錢結(jié)婚。
幸福在于知足。2022年1月17日上海。